Some spoilers below if you haven't watched the game, so... yeah.

Curse vs Vulcun really put into perspective one of the things I hate about the current state of the game: how hard it is to peel. If you watch Zuna during the game, he just had no chance to ever do anything in a fight. Curse decided that they were just going to barrel in on Vayne and that's what happened. Now, part of that was because Nidalee was not often there, so the engagements were often 4v5 (sometimes just 4v4, though), but the problem would have been the same with or without Nid. GGU had Lulu, Sona, and Hecarim, so it's not like they didn't have peel. It just didn't matter. So irritating that you can just stack HP and charge through damage to kill someone who had no mid-game survivability options.

Scarra was in mid. He was playing Kayle.

CLG's problem that game was that they really only had one damage threat. Link was playing way too sloppy. I get trying to initiate with Ahri's Charm, and it works, but he needed to let someone else do the follow-up. He was trying to dash in and combo someone down, which just led to him getting annihilated and CLG only having Kog for damage. He needed to skirt around the fights and use Ahri's mobility to stay alive, not try to burst someone down (the enemy team having Kayle already makes that a pretty bad proposition).

I was just really surprised they let Dig have Kayle. Scarra has said multiple times that they think Kayle is one of the most broken champions right now and that they'll always pick her if she's available because they have three players (I'm sure you could call it 4, but I don't think they'd go back to putting her in bot lane) who are all very confident in how they play the champ. And, clearly, whatever CLG thought they had to deal with Kayle did not work. Overall, though, the game was pretty close, and a great one to watch.

Yeah, a lot of mid laners have switched to playing bruisers and assassins in mid lane because damage is cheaper and armor is more expensive and AP doesn't scale as high into late game anymore (in general; obviously if you're ultra fed ultra...).

Xin is one of the strongest junglers right now because basically no one out-damages him early game and his ganks are strong and he has a 15% armor shred.
